Thomas Mariani, Steven O’Rourke and Sarah Himmelhoch received the 2016 Homeland Security and Law Enforcement Medal Sept. 20, at the 2016 Service to America Medals ceremony. Read the full story here.
The trio negotiated a $20.8 billion settlement against BP in the aftermath of the Deepwater Horizon oil spill. This was the biggest civil penalty ever brought against a single defendant. The funds finance the largest environmental restoration program in U.S. history.
“The scale of this case, the number of people involved and the amount of injury that took place was huge,” said Lois Schiffer, general counsel of the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ration. “They were under a lot of pressure and very difficult circumstances, but they navigated the case to a highly successful conclusion for the benefit of the public and the environment.”
